A bit of background and description of the problem:

I just purchased this boat. Prior to purchasing I had an inspection done by a locally recommended inspector and following that I had the recommended repairs made before purchasing the boat. The repairs were made by a local marina and included:

Replaced thermostats
Water pump Impellers
and a Seal on one the trim tabs

When I picked the boat up on Saturday everything seemed to run great. We had about a 20 minute run from the marina where the service was performed to our slip. We overnighted at the slip and the next morning we filled up with fuel and headed out.

After filling up with fuel we ran for about 20 minutes when the starboard engine suddenly shutdown. It would start again pretty easily but would surge at idle. If I attempted to give it any throttle it would die again. We headed back to the slip with one engine.

Any ideas?

Engine details below

Volvo Penta I/O, Gasoline, V8 235HP
Serial Number of Starboard Engine - 4110130116

Since your problem occured just after refuelling I would sure be pulling the fuel filter off the engine, pouring the contents into a clear container and looking for water or debris in the fuel. (Do not reinstall the old filter, put on a new one)

PS, the serial number helped, you have a 96 Ford EFI engine

make sure the fuel vent is not plugged, when it is running poorly try loosening the fuel cap and see if it sucks in air and runs better, i had this problem and one engine would bogg down b 4 the other for some reason, just a shot in the dark good luck

See if you can find my entrie thread as I did give updates until I figured it out. Ultimately it was my upper and lower intake manifold gaskets and or lower intake bolts not being torqued properly. I had replaced my long block and rebuilt/replaced everything else. I must have gotten sloppy and missed the lower intake bolts. In any case, I replaced all the gaskets when I went back through it. It runs great now. There are many things that can cause your problem. 20 mins is just long enough for it to warm up and give the EEC reasons to change your mixture, this may be where you should be looking. The mixture may be leaning too much and causing it to stall. In my case, the intake air leak was more than the computer could compensate for at idle but at higher RPM it could. One thing to check, since you have 2 engines, watch your temp on both, the faulty engine is likely running hotter due to the lean condition. If this is true, then an air leak is becoming more likely. As far as self diagnosing the EEC, you can do it your self easily. Go to Fordfuelinjection.org and follow the instructions. All you need is a muti-meter or cheap test light. In my case though, I got an all clear code because the problem was with too much air. The computer has no way to measure how much air is coming in above the amount it is programmed to assume. Let me know if your engine will run good at say 2000rpm+. Also be sure to check the simple things, fuel lines, anti-siphon, etc... If you want, PM me your ph# and a good time to call . I finally made my way to the top of the queue it the second service center. I now appreciate why the line was so long. They diagnosed the problem and had it fixed the same day. It was the low pressure fuel pump on the starboard engine. Yes the same one the previous mechanic claimed to have swapped with no success. I ran the boat all day yesterday with no issues.
